#How to Frame CTR

Many factors drive one result
Many factors drive one result

CTR is driven by a whole system of factors working together:

The video ideaWhether there's real demand for it.
The titleHow much curiosity it creates.
The thumbnailWhether it stops the scroll.
Autoplay-on-hoverThe first 2-3 seconds.
Channel reputationThe viewer's previous experience with the channel.
Feed contextWhat other videos are surrounding theirs in the feed.
Algorithm testingHow YouTube's algorithm is testing it against other content.
TimingTime of posting and audience activity windows.
Promise vs. payoffWhether the title/thumbnail combo creates an expectation the video delivers on.

Nobody has a secret formula for YouTube. Video is a creative, subjective medium. What works is consistency, iteration, testing, and some luck. The strategy doc stacks the odds in their favor.

#Subscriptions & Retainers

The path from one-off order to locked-in recurring revenue:

1
One-off orderdeliver clean, build trust on the first project.
2
Volume / recurring pricingonce a recurring pattern is established, discuss volume rates.
3
Subscriptionper-order delivery (e.g., weekly) with each approval transitioning to the next order in the set.
4
Monthly retainerX deliverables/month at a locked rate, priority turnaround, consistent style, no re-quoting.

#Subscription Mechanics

Per-order deliverySubscription orders deliver per-order (e.g., weekly). Each order's approval transitions to the next order in the set.
Close-out languageSubscription close-outs use the standard 3-option language, but the review is valued at the subscription level (the relationship is already locked).
Watch the renewal windowAs a subscription nears its final order, start warming the renewal conversation. Close it on the final order.

#Structuring a Retainer

  • Locked per-unit rateX deliverables/month at a rate slightly below standard as a volume incentive
  • Priority turnaroundfaster queue position for retainer clients
  • Consistent stylesame look across every deliverable
  • No re-quotingthe rate is fixed for the retainer period
  • Bundle natural add-onswork intro/outro design, thumbnails, and shorts/clips into the retainer conversation
